How they compare
Central African Republic currently reports 533,148 against 521,821 in Turkmenistan, a difference of 11,327.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 26 shared years of data; in 1990 it was Turkmenistan ahead.
Central African Republic ranks 106th and Turkmenistan ranks 107th of 191 countries.
Turkmenistan has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Central African Republic | Turkmenistan |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 316,573 | 399,378 | 82,805 | Turkmenistan |
| 2000s | 419,487 | 514,775 | 95,287 | Turkmenistan |
| 2010s | 508,763 | 549,479 | 40,716 | Turkmenistan |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
